The Marshville Heritage Festival has been a Labour Day tradition in Wainfleet since 1988 โ and Country Boys has been part of Marshville, since the beginning. Weโre proud to be one of the festivalโs longtime food vendors.

Walk through a recreated 19th-century rural village and spend the day exploring:
โ๏ธ Blacksmithing & traditional demonstrations
๐ช The working historic Dean Sawmill
๐๏ธ Restored heritage buildings
๐ Antique machinery
๐จ 50+ artisans & craft vendors
๐ Train rides
๐ถ Live music & entertainment
๐ Vintage car shows
๐จโ๐ฉโ๐งโ๐ฆ Kidsโ activities
๐ And, naturallyโฆ Country Boys
The Dean Sawmill runs demonstrations throughout the weekend at 11 AM, 1 PM and 3 PM.
๐ And every day brings something different to the car-show field, with classic vehicles throughout the weekend and British cars, Volkswagens and vintage motorcycles taking over Labour Day Monday.
Admission is $8 for adults, children under 10 are free, and parking is free with covered people movers running from the parking area.
